Output 74df66136d424476d0286774db52d402a824204a6088ceddd12c50ba0d42ccaa:0

value
86998728
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d5e5472bf165cfe5c3d0c150884d6b843a88f14 OP_EQUAL
address
3JxJdxJo4ZWXUV19EFpMPg2FDc4zHz5s6M
transaction
74df66136d424476d0286774db52d402a824204a6088ceddd12c50ba0d42ccaa
confirmations
108064
spent
true